User roles and features

This topic describes the user roles for this product, their goals, and additional information related to tasks.

User role

Tasks

Reference

CMDB Administrators

  • Installing BMC Atrium Core components
  • Determining how to allocate server and database resources
  • Managing BMC Atrium Core access control by assigning permissions for BMC Atrium Core applications and their components
  • Maintaining BMC Atrium Core by adding and deleting users, groups, and roles; backing up BMC Remedy AR System servers; importing data from other systems
